Bug 89713

Summary: Pixel cracks possible in flexbox when deviceScaleFactor is greater than 1
Product: WebKit Reporter: Beth Dakin <bdakin>
Component: Layout and RenderingAssignee: Nobody <webkit-unassigned>
Status: NEW    
Severity: Normal CC: ahmad.saleem792, bdakin, simon.fraser, webkit-bug-importer, zalan
Priority: P2 Keywords: InRadar, LayoutTestFailure
Version: 528+ (Nightly build)   
Hardware: Unspecified   
OS: Unspecified   

Beth Dakin
Reported 2012-06-21 17:11:01 PDT
These three layout tests fail when you run them on a Retina Macbook Pro or any Mac running in HiDPI mode: ietestcenter/css3/flexbox/flexbox-align-baseline-001.htm ietestcenter/css3/flexbox/flexbox-align-center-001.htm ietestcenter/css3/flexbox/flexbox-align-center-002.htm The results seem to indicate pixel cracks are the problem. It would be nice in the short term to have a new directory like the platform directory for test results that are specific to different deviceScaleFactors.
Attachments
Radar WebKit Bug Importer
Comment 1 2012-06-21 17:11:59 PDT
Ahmad Saleem
Comment 2 2023-02-24 08:56:03 PST
We don't have these as failure on macOS text expectation but have it on iOS: https://searchfox.org/wubkat/source/LayoutTests/platform/ios/TestExpectations#1362 Are these [ ImageOnlyFailure ] tracked with this bug? Or we can close this because this was for Mac?
Sam Sneddon [:gsnedders]
Comment 3 2025-05-22 16:45:39 PDT
On macOS we haven't run tests in HiDPI mode for a very long time; but we do for iOS. That said, this definitely still occurs: imported/w3c/web-platform-tests/css/css-flexbox/align-self-001.html has a whole load of cracks that makes it fail at 3x — and test results look much worse at 3x than 2x.
Note You need to log in before you can comment on or make changes to this bug.